Obituary for GALLEGOS


Published in the Albuquerque Journal on Friday December 12, 2008

Manuelita Gallegos, 94 years old, from Vallecitos, New Mexico, went home with the Lord on Wednesday, December 10, 2008. She was born to Ambrosio Martinez and Emilia Maestas all residents of Vallecitos. Mane was preceded in death by her husband Crestino Gallegos; and her two sons Eli and Joe Max Gallegos. She is survived by her family Mary Frances and Carlos Santistevan, Walter Gallegos and Yvonne Gonzales, Lorraine and Sam Baca, Mike and Amanda Gallegos, Sally and Skip Skinner, all from Albuquerque; Benny and Linda Gallegos from Oklahoma; Billy and Elizabeth Gallegos from Flagstaff, AZ, and Charlene and Gary Burriss from Virginia. Mane is also survived by her younger sister Carlotta Jaramillo; and was blessed with 22 grandchildren, 21 great-grandchildren, many nieces and nephews, and many friends. Manuelita dearly loved all of her children and grandchildren, and like any matriarch, enjoyed cooking and caring for all of them. She brought love and laughter and great inspiration to her entire family and to everyone she met. She will be greatly missed. Public Viewing and Rosary will be held at Risen Savior Catholic Church on Wyoming on Friday, December 12, 2008 beginning at 6:30 p.m. Funeral Mass will be held at the Saint John the Baptist- San Juan Catholic Church in San Juan Pueblo (just north of Espanola) on Saturday, December 13, 2008 at 12:30 p.m.; a Reception will follow with the body lying in State for one hour, followed by interment in the Vallecitos cemetery.
